> I am installing OpenStack Folsom on Fedora 18.
> 
> The openstack dashboard is very slow and its giving the following error
> message:
> 
> Error: Unable to retrieve quota information.

Hello! Could you look at the httpd logs and copy the stack trace that happens 
when you see that error?

You might also want to check that the nova-network service is up and running. 
Because it takes about a minute (by default) to time out, it could be what's 
causing the slowness (see e.g. https://bugs.launchpad.net/horizon/+bug/1079882 )
